Workshop Scope

This workshop provides operations and maintenance personnel of pipeline companies with the knowledge to properly determine if an anomaly should be replaced or repaired. This workshop also introduces pipeline operations and maintenance personnel to alternative pipeline repair techniques: sleeves, composites, and direct deposit weld repairs.

The economics, technology, application techniques, and materials, currently available will be discussed.

The workshop will examine defect identification plus assessment for replacement or repair decisions and will review current smart practices in the field.

Also included are demonstrations of repair methods.

 

Who Should Attend

Operations and maintenance personnel responsible for the decision of repair versus replacement and the materials and technology to be utilized.  Both transmission and distribution operators will benefit from this training.
